How Much Does a Financial Advisor Cost in Dumfries?

Financial advisor costs in Dumfries, Scotland range from £150–£300/hour. Compare local rates & services on BizHub365.

Financial advisor fees in Dumfries vary depending on the complexity of your situation, whether you need ongoing advice or a one-off consultation, and the advisor's qualifications and experience. Some charge hourly rates, whilst others work on a fixed-fee or percentage-of-assets-under-management (AUM) basis. Financial Advisor Prices in Dumfries

Service Typical Cost Unit
Initial consultation £0 – £150 per appointment
Hourly financial advice £150 – £250 per hour
Retirement planning (fixed fee) £800 – £2000 per project
Investment portfolio review £500 – £1500 per review
Ongoing wealth management £0.5 – £1.5 % of assets per year
Mortgage advice & protection review £300 – £750 per project
Tax planning consultation £200 – £500 per session
Inheritance & estate planning £1000 – £3000 per plan

Prices are indicative averages for Dumfries. Actual quotes will vary based on job specifics.

What Affects the Cost?

The main factors affecting financial advisor pricing in Dumfries include: the complexity of your financial situation (number of assets, income streams, dependents); whether you need one-off advice or ongoing management; the advisor's qualifications, experience, and regulatory status (IFA vs. restricted advisors); and the scope of services (general advice vs. specialist planning). Local advisors may offer competitive Scottish rates, whilst some clients prefer larger firms with broader resources.

Money-Saving Tips

To reduce costs: compare hourly rates versus fixed-fee structures based on your needs; ask about free initial consultations; bundle services (e.g. mortgages + protection) with one advisor; consider restricted advisors for specific products if fully independent advice isn't necessary; and ask whether ongoing annual reviews are included in any fixed-fee arrangement.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why do financial advisor fees vary so much?
Fees depend on qualifications (FCA-regulated independent financial advisors charge more), experience level, service scope, and whether you're paying for one-off advice or ongoing portfolio management. Some advisors offer free consultations; others charge upfront. AUM-based fees suit larger portfolios, whilst hourly rates work better for specific questions.
What's the difference between an IFA and a restricted advisor?
An Independent Financial Advisor (IFA) can recommend any product on the market and typically charges more. A restricted advisor only recommends products from a limited panel (e.g. their employer's range) and may charge less. Both are FCA-regulated, but IFAs offer broader choice.
Is the initial consultation always free in Dumfries?
Many local Dumfries advisors offer free initial consultations to discuss your needs, though some may charge £75–£150. Always ask upfront. This lets you compare advisors' approach and qualifications before committing to paid advice.
Should I choose hourly rates or fixed fees?
Hourly rates (£150–£250/hour) suit simple queries or sporadic advice. Fixed fees (£800–£3,000) work better for defined projects like retirement planning. AUM fees (0.5–1.5% annually) suit long-term portfolio management with ongoing reviews included.
